The Fundamentals of Epoxy Shot Molding
Epoxy shot molding is a fascinating procedure that integrates accuracy and convenience to develop resilient components. You start by mixing epoxy material with a hardener, which launches a chain reaction, leading to a solid product. The mix's viscosity enables it to move quickly right into molds, catching intricate details and complicated shapes.Once the epoxy is injected into the mold, it cures under regulated temperature level and pressure, making certain a solid bond and outstanding architectural integrity. You can adjust the formulation, permitting for boosted buildings such as increased resistance to chemicals or improved thermal stability.This procedure is particularly valuable for producing intricate components made use of in numerous markets, consisting of automobile, aerospace, and electronics. By leveraging epoxy shot molding, you're able to achieve high-quality, light-weight components that meet stringent performance demands.
